ABSTRACT

Scientific discoveries have taken advantage of the unique chemical and physical properties of metals to enable creation of a myriad of high-tech products that have transformed twenty-first-century society. However, due to the finite primary supply of precious metals, their burgeoning consumption by consumers and industry is unsustainable without efficient recycling. Vastly improved value recovery from end-of-life metal products is needed, both by increasing the rate of metal recycling and by improving the performance of recycling technologies. Considerable efforts are therefore being made to develop an integrated approach to metallurgical processing of urban-mined resources. This chapter introduces industrial-scale state-of-the-art integrated routes for efficient recovery/recycling of precious metals from various urban mines. Several integrated industrial processes are described in detail as case studies, accompanied by systematic schematics and/or process flow sheets.
